数据库关系的性质包括什么

fiy 其他 92

回复

共3条回复 我来回复
  • 不及物动词的头像
    不及物动词
    这个人很懒,什么都没有留下~
    评论

    数据库关系的性质包括以下几点:

    1. 唯一性(Uniqueness):关系模型要求每个关系中的元组都是唯一的,即不存在两个完全相同的元组。这是通过定义主键来实现的,主键是关系中的一个或多个属性组合,用来唯一标识一个元组。

    2. 原子性(Atomicity):关系中的每个属性都是不可再分的原子值,即一个属性不能再分解成更小的单位。这意味着每个属性只能包含一个值,而不能是多个值的集合。

    3. 有序性(Ordering):关系中的元组是无序的,即没有明确的顺序。这是因为关系模型是基于集合论的,而在集合中,元素的顺序是无关紧要的。

    4. 可变性(Mutability):关系中的元组和属性的值是可变的,即可以进行插入、删除和更新操作。这使得数据库能够随着时间的推移而发生变化,并反映实际情况的更新。

    5. 关联性(Association):关系模型通过属性之间的关联来表示不同实体之间的关系。这是通过在关系中定义外键来实现的,外键是一个属性,它引用了其他关系中的主键,用于建立关系之间的联系。

    总结起来,数据库关系的性质包括唯一性、原子性、有序性、可变性和关联性。这些性质为数据库提供了高效、可靠和灵活的数据管理和查询能力。

    1年前 0条评论
  • worktile的头像
    worktile
    Worktile官方账号
    评论

    数据库关系的性质包括以下几个方面:

    1. 唯一性(Uniqueness):关系中的每一行都具有唯一标识,即每一行的主键(Primary Key)值都是唯一的,用来区分不同的行。

    2. 原子性(Atomicity):关系中的每一个属性(Attribute)都是不可再分的最小数据单元,不能再分解成更小的数据项。

    3. 基数性(Cardinality):关系中的每一行都包含了一组相关的数据项,每个数据项对应关系模式中的一个属性。

    4. 完整性(Integrity):关系中的数据必须满足一定的完整性约束,包括实体完整性、参照完整性和用户定义的完整性约束。

    5. 一致性(Consistency):关系中的数据必须满足一定的一致性要求,即数据项之间的相互关系必须是合理和正确的。

    6. 可读性(Readability):关系中的数据应该是易于理解和阅读的,对于用户来说,能够方便地获取所需的信息。

    7. 可更新性(Updatability):关系中的数据可以进行添加、修改和删除操作,保证了数据的动态性和灵活性。

    8. 随机性(Randomness):关系中的数据是无序的,即数据项之间没有特定的顺序,可以按照需要进行排序。

    9. 独立性(Independence):关系中的数据是与具体应用程序无关的,可以独立于应用程序进行管理和操作。

    10. 持久性(Persistence):关系中的数据是持久化存储的,即数据可以长期保存,并且在需要时可以进行恢复和访问。

    这些性质是关系型数据库设计和管理的基本原则,能够保证数据的可靠性、一致性和有效性,提供高效的数据存储和查询功能。

    1年前 0条评论
  • fiy的头像
    fiy
    Worktile&PingCode市场小伙伴
    评论

    数据库关系的性质包括以下几个方面:

    1. 唯一性:数据库关系中的每一行都是唯一的,没有重复的行。这是通过主键来实现的,主键是一个唯一标识符,用来唯一标识每一行数据。

    2. 原子性:数据库关系中的每一列都是原子的,即不可再分的。每个列都包含一个单一的值,不能包含多个值或多个数据项。

    3. 定义性:数据库关系需要有明确的定义,即每一列都必须有一个定义好的数据类型。这样可以确保数据的一致性和完整性。

    4. 有序性:数据库关系中的行和列是有序的,即行和列的顺序是固定的,不会发生变化。

    5. 可变性:数据库关系中的数据是可以进行修改的,可以进行插入、更新和删除操作。

    6. 一致性:数据库关系中的数据必须保持一致性,即数据之间的关系是正确的。例如,在两个表之间建立外键关系时,必须保证外键的值在主表中存在。

    7. 粒度性:数据库关系中的数据可以按照不同的粒度进行操作,可以以整个关系、行、列或单个单元格为单位进行操作。

    8. 可靠性:数据库关系中的数据必须是可靠的,即数据的正确性和完整性得到了保证。这可以通过事务来实现,事务是一组数据库操作的逻辑单元,要么全部执行成功,要么全部回滚。

    这些性质是数据库关系的基本特征,它们保证了数据库中数据的正确性、一致性和可靠性。在设计和使用数据库时,需要遵循这些性质,以确保数据库的正常运行和有效管理。

    1年前 0条评论
注册PingCode 在线客服
站长微信
站长微信
电话联系

400-800-1024

工作日9:30-21:00在线

分享本页
返回顶部